Rahn, CSUSM Capture Victories at Lady Bulldog Desert Classic
Tournament: Lady Bulldog Desert Classic
Date: Monday, Sept. 29, 2025
Location: Palm Desert, Calif.
Course: Avondale Golf Club (par-72)
Team Winner: Cal State San Marcos (875, +11)
Individual Medalist & Top Cougar: CSUSM's Chloe Rahn (213, 3-under par)
COURSE REPORT:
The Cal State San Marcos women's golf team dominated the field at the Lady Bulldog Desert Classic, claiming the team title with a final score of 11-over 875 (297-291-287) after three rounds played at Avondale Golf Club on Monday. The Cougars were the only team to post a sub-par round, closing with a 1-under 287 to seal the victory.
FIRST TEE:
- Chloe Rahn led the Cougars and the entire field as an individual, finishing 3-under 213 (71-68-74) with a tournament-high 12 birdie count.
- Kiara Hernandez placed second overall at 1-under par 215 (70-73-72), carding multiple birdies across all three rounds.
- Carmella Carlisi tied for third with a 3-over 219 (73-70-76), highlighted by a strong second round.
- Abby Sickles and Avery Foster both tied for fifth at 6-over 222. Sickles posted rounds of 77-75-70 while Foster shot 77-73-72.
- Ellaclair Leedom rounded out the team scoring in a tie for 10th at 12-over 228 (77-78-73), finishing strong with a 1-over final round.
- Hannah Anderson (IND) tied for 17th at 16-over 232 (78-79-75).
- Nataliya Laciste (IND) placed 26th at 24-over 240 (78-79-83).

INSIDE THE SCORECARD:
- CSUSM claimed both the team and individual titles, with Chloe Rahn earning medalist honors at 3-under par.
- This was Rahn's first collegiate win.
- The Cougars have won both of their fall tournaments to begin the 2025-26 season.
- CSUSM led the field with 44 birdies with second-place Union finishing with 30.
UP NEXT:
CSUSM will head to Colorado for the NCAA West Regional Preview on Oct. 13-14. The tournament will be held at Pueblo Country Club in Pueblo, Colorado.
